Why We Think This Is A Scam

Domain registered only 2 hours ago but claims 2.4M+ users, $2.1B trading volume, and 7 years in the market—clear fabrication given newness.
Branding includes 'AI' and 'quantum' terminology, common buzzwords for modern investment scams.
References to insurance fund and ISO 27001 processes attempt to establish a false sense of security (KYC/AML theater, pseudo-legalese).
Promises fast withdrawals ('Withdrawals in minutes') often used to conceal actual withdrawal issues typical in scam operations.
No verifiable company registration number, physical address, or independently verifiable team/leadership mentioned.
Email/phone data collection (in form) signals possible lead-harvesting for pig-butchering outreach.
Ambiguous or recycled legalese ('Risk disclosure,' 'insurance fund') and broken interface texts observed.
